Strategies for creating an visually attractive resume
The art of creating a visually attractive resume doesn’t require rocket science but it does require some effort and creativity. Here are some suggestions that can help:
Choose appropriate fonts
The font you select can influence the way your resume will be perceived. Choose clear and easy-to-read fonts such as Arial or Times New Roman. Beware of cursive or decorative fonts that may be hard to read.
Use bullet points
Bullet points are an efficient method of organizing information in a simple and concise way. They make your resume easier to read, and also emphasize key skills and accomplishments.
Include color
Utilizing color in a strategic way can make sure that the most important sections are highlighted that make up your resume. For example applying a different color for your name or section headers will help them stand out.
White space
Be sure to leave plenty of white space between the sections on your resume so that it doesn’t look messy or overwhelming. This will make the document more reader-friendly.

Common Questions and Answers
What is the importance of the appearance of your resume?
A visually appealing resume is sure to draw the attention of hiring managers as well as recruiters, making your resume more memorable in their eyes. It will also show that you have excellent design skills or a solid grasp of aesthetics. These can be important for certain jobs.
What are some helpful tips for making a resume that is visually appealing?
Be sure that your text is simple to read using clear, clean fonts, a proper size of font, and enough white space. Make use of color sparingly in order to emphasize important aspects like section titles or key skills. Use bullet points, headings, and short sentences to break up large blocks of text.
Does having a resume that isn’t appealing reduce my chances of getting an interview?
Yes. A poorly-written resume can make employers turn away potential employers who receive countless resumes for every job advertisement. In the event that your resume proves hard to understand or has no visual appeal it is unlikely that they will take the time needed to review your credentials.
Are there any specific industries that value attractive resumes more so than others?
Industries such as graphic design and advertising place a high value on aesthetics and will likely require resumes that show design expertise. However, all industries could gain from resumes that are easy on the eyes and include thoughtful use of design.
What else should I be thinking about when designing a visually attractive resume?
Remember that content remains king. A visually stunning but empty resume won’t get you too far. Be sure your resume is unique, compelling and highlights your most pertinent successes and accomplishments to increase your chances of being invited in for an interview.
